Project Number Date
test_Tails_ISO_21348-migrate-away-from-sysadmin-team-container-images 4 17 Jun 2026, 19:29

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 268 0 0 0 0 268 21 0 21 35:4.914 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
52.943
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.017
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.972
And I log in to a new session in German (de) 29.067
Then the live user's Documents directory exists 0.046
And there is a GNOME bookmark for the Documents directory 14.857
After features/support/hooks.rb:339 1.116
After features/support/hooks.rb:108 0.000
Tags: @product
49.556
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.014
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.460
And I log in to a new session in German (de) 27.208
Then the live user's Downloads directory exists 0.058
And there is a GNOME bookmark for the Downloads directory 14.828
After features/support/hooks.rb:339 1.200
After features/support/hooks.rb:108 0.000
Tags: @product
49.954
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.016
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.004
And I log in to a new session in German (de) 27.456
Then the live user's Music directory exists 0.039
And there is a GNOME bookmark for the Music directory 14.454
After features/support/hooks.rb:339 1.139
After features/support/hooks.rb:108 0.000
Tags: @product
50.892
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.016
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.595
And I log in to a new session in German (de) 28.527
Then the live user's Pictures directory exists 0.048
And there is a GNOME bookmark for the Pictures directory 14.721
After features/support/hooks.rb:339 1.326
After features/support/hooks.rb:108 0.000
Tags: @product
52.054
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.029
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.809
And I log in to a new session in German (de) 29.636
Then the live user's Videos directory exists 0.043
And there is a GNOME bookmark for the Videos directory 14.564
After features/support/hooks.rb:339 1.202
After features/support/hooks.rb:108 0.000
2:0.301
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.018
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.814
And I set an administration password 6.805
When I log in to a new session in Arabic (ar) 26.441
Then the keyboard layout is set to "eg" 0.113
And tpsd is localized to the selected locale 0.137
Given the network is plugged 0.020
And Tor is ready 11.719
Then I successfully start the Unsafe Browser 5.528
And I kill the Unsafe Browser 5.221
Given Thunderbird is installed 27.643
When I enable the screen keyboard 0.100
Then the screen keyboard works in Tor Browser 12.414
And DuckDuckGo is the default search engine 5.637
And I kill the Tor Browser 5.283
And the screen keyboard works in Thunderbird 4.977
And the layout of the screen keyboard is set to "us" 0.441
After features/support/hooks.rb:339 1.775
After features/support/hooks.rb:108 0.000
1:57.488
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.018
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.130
And I set an administration password 6.837
When I log in to a new session in Chinese (zh_CN) 26.729
Then the keyboard layout is set to "cn" 0.116
And tpsd is localized to the selected locale 0.096
Given the network is plugged 0.013
And Tor is ready 11.735
Then I successfully start the Unsafe Browser 5.665
And I kill the Unsafe Browser 5.331
Given Thunderbird is installed 24.786
When I enable the screen keyboard 0.086
Then the screen keyboard works in Tor Browser 11.898
And DuckDuckGo is the default search engine 5.676
And I kill the Tor Browser 5.236
And the screen keyboard works in Thunderbird 4.655
And the layout of the screen keyboard is set to "us" 0.487
After features/support/hooks.rb:339 1.545
After features/support/hooks.rb:108 0.000
1:46.664
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.019
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.432
And I set an administration password 6.831
When I log in to a new session in English (en) 12.047
Then the keyboard layout is set to "us" 0.144
And tpsd is localized to the selected locale 0.104
Given the network is plugged 0.018
And Tor is ready 11.860
Then I successfully start the Unsafe Browser 6.225
And I kill the Unsafe Browser 5.182
Given Thunderbird is installed 27.998
When I enable the screen keyboard 0.070
Then the screen keyboard works in Tor Browser 12.383
And DuckDuckGo is the default search engine 4.140
And I kill the Tor Browser 5.285
And the screen keyboard works in Thunderbird 5.516
And the layout of the screen keyboard is set to "us" 0.422
After features/support/hooks.rb:339 1.433
After features/support/hooks.rb:108 0.000
1:59.155
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.022
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.665
And I set an administration password 6.875
When I log in to a new session in French (fr) 27.201
Then the keyboard layout is set to "fr" 0.126
And tpsd is localized to the selected locale 0.109
Given the network is plugged 0.031
And Tor is ready 11.571
Then I successfully start the Unsafe Browser 5.749
And I kill the Unsafe Browser 5.196
Given Thunderbird is installed 27.523
When I enable the screen keyboard 0.060
Then the screen keyboard works in Tor Browser 11.000
And DuckDuckGo is the default search engine 5.488
And I kill the Tor Browser 5.309
And the screen keyboard works in Thunderbird 4.775
And the layout of the screen keyboard is set to "fr" 0.471
After features/support/hooks.rb:339 1.050
After features/support/hooks.rb:108 0.000
1:57.361
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.015
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.944
And I set an administration password 6.882
When I log in to a new session in German (de) 26.850
Then the keyboard layout is set to "de" 0.128
And tpsd is localized to the selected locale 0.116
Given the network is plugged 0.015
And Tor is ready 12.200
Then I successfully start the Unsafe Browser 6.157
And I kill the Unsafe Browser 5.220
Given Thunderbird is installed 23.995
When I enable the screen keyboard 0.074
Then the screen keyboard works in Tor Browser 12.381
And DuckDuckGo is the default search engine 5.139
And I kill the Tor Browser 5.263
And the screen keyboard works in Thunderbird 4.587
And the layout of the screen keyboard is set to "de" 0.402
After features/support/hooks.rb:339 1.430
After features/support/hooks.rb:108 0.000
2:1.405
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.015
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.118
And I set an administration password 6.945
When I log in to a new session in Hindi (hi) 27.660
Then the keyboard layout is set to "in" 0.099
And tpsd is localized to the selected locale 0.112
Given the network is plugged 0.020
And Tor is ready 12.482
Then I successfully start the Unsafe Browser 5.248
And I kill the Unsafe Browser 5.232
Given Thunderbird is installed 27.683
When I enable the screen keyboard 0.086
Then the screen keyboard works in Tor Browser 11.854
And DuckDuckGo is the default search engine 5.077
And I kill the Tor Browser 5.223
And the screen keyboard works in Thunderbird 5.053
And the layout of the screen keyboard is set to "us" 0.507
After features/support/hooks.rb:339 1.556
After features/support/hooks.rb:108 0.000
1:56.076
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.030
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.370
And I set an administration password 6.889
When I log in to a new session in Indonesian (id) 27.165
Then the keyboard layout is set to "id" 0.096
And tpsd is localized to the selected locale 0.091
Given the network is plugged 0.015
And Tor is ready 11.533
Then I successfully start the Unsafe Browser 5.532
And I kill the Unsafe Browser 5.210
Given Thunderbird is installed 24.661
When I enable the screen keyboard 0.083
Then the screen keyboard works in Tor Browser 11.376
And DuckDuckGo is the default search engine 5.332
And I kill the Tor Browser 5.226
And the screen keyboard works in Thunderbird 5.030
And the layout of the screen keyboard is set to "us" 0.459
After features/support/hooks.rb:339 1.491
After features/support/hooks.rb:108 0.000
1:58.705
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.022
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.596
And I set an administration password 6.887
When I log in to a new session in Italian (it) 25.914
Then the keyboard layout is set to "it" 0.097
And tpsd is localized to the selected locale 0.079
Given the network is plugged 0.017
And Tor is ready 11.761
Then I successfully start the Unsafe Browser 6.439
And I kill the Unsafe Browser 5.249
Given Thunderbird is installed 27.494
When I enable the screen keyboard 0.080
Then the screen keyboard works in Tor Browser 11.617
And DuckDuckGo is the default search engine 5.062
And I kill the Tor Browser 5.173
And the screen keyboard works in Thunderbird 4.827
And the layout of the screen keyboard is set to "us" 0.405
After features/support/hooks.rb:339 1.286
After features/support/hooks.rb:108 0.000
2:4.100
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.014
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.479
And I set an administration password 6.853
When I log in to a new session in Persian (fa) 27.282
Then the keyboard layout is set to "ir" 0.122
And tpsd is localized to the selected locale 0.141
Given the network is plugged 0.016
And Tor is ready 12.037
Then I successfully start the Unsafe Browser 5.096
And I kill the Unsafe Browser 5.195
Given Thunderbird is installed 27.864
When I enable the screen keyboard 0.122
Then the screen keyboard works in Tor Browser 15.493
And DuckDuckGo is the default search engine 5.814
And I kill the Tor Browser 5.342
And the screen keyboard works in Thunderbird 4.846
And the layout of the screen keyboard is set to "ir" 0.391
After features/support/hooks.rb:339 1.293
After features/support/hooks.rb:108 0.000
2:1.046
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.015
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.390
And I set an administration password 6.953
When I log in to a new session in Portuguese (pt) 26.167
Then the keyboard layout is set to "pt" 0.098
And tpsd is localized to the selected locale 0.111
Given the network is plugged 0.014
And Tor is ready 12.037
Then I successfully start the Unsafe Browser 5.622
And I kill the Unsafe Browser 5.191
Given Thunderbird is installed 28.254
When I enable the screen keyboard 0.093
Then the screen keyboard works in Tor Browser 13.467
And DuckDuckGo is the default search engine 5.529
And I kill the Tor Browser 5.232
And the screen keyboard works in Thunderbird 4.473
And the layout of the screen keyboard is set to "us" 0.410
After features/support/hooks.rb:339 1.194
After features/support/hooks.rb:108 0.000
1:59.931
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.015
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.721
And I set an administration password 6.911
When I log in to a new session in Russian (ru) 26.760
Then the keyboard layout is set to "ru" 0.137
And tpsd is localized to the selected locale 0.101
Given the network is plugged 0.017
And Tor is ready 11.583
Then I successfully start the Unsafe Browser 5.359
And I kill the Unsafe Browser 5.189
Given Thunderbird is installed 27.764
When I enable the screen keyboard 0.102
Then the screen keyboard works in Tor Browser 12.343
And DuckDuckGo is the default search engine 5.746
And I kill the Tor Browser 5.191
And the screen keyboard works in Thunderbird 4.536
And the layout of the screen keyboard is set to "ru" 0.463
After features/support/hooks.rb:339 1.497
After features/support/hooks.rb:108 0.000
1:55.455
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.017
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.814
And I set an administration password 6.807
When I log in to a new session in Spanish (es) 25.491
Then the keyboard layout is set to "es" 0.112
And tpsd is localized to the selected locale 0.165
Given the network is plugged 0.017
And Tor is ready 11.963
Then I successfully start the Unsafe Browser 4.513
And I kill the Unsafe Browser 5.216
Given Thunderbird is installed 27.370
When I enable the screen keyboard 0.101
Then the screen keyboard works in Tor Browser 10.315
And DuckDuckGo is the default search engine 5.239
And I kill the Tor Browser 5.282
And the screen keyboard works in Thunderbird 4.639
And the layout of the screen keyboard is set to "us" 0.401
After features/support/hooks.rb:339 1.215
After features/support/hooks.rb:108 0.000
1:59.049
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.018
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.812
And I set an administration password 6.875
When I log in to a new session in Turkish (tr) 27.257
Then the keyboard layout is set to "tr" 0.110
And tpsd is localized to the selected locale 0.105
Given the network is plugged 0.023
And Tor is ready 11.789
Then I successfully start the Unsafe Browser 5.595
And I kill the Unsafe Browser 5.187
Given Thunderbird is installed 27.626
When I enable the screen keyboard 0.073
Then the screen keyboard works in Tor Browser 10.340
And DuckDuckGo is the default search engine 5.778
And I kill the Tor Browser 5.257
And the screen keyboard works in Thunderbird 4.815
And the layout of the screen keyboard is set to "us" 0.399
After features/support/hooks.rb:339 1.148
After features/support/hooks.rb:108 0.000
Tags: @product
1:5.687
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.017
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 9.029
When I set the language to Italian (it) 5.631
Then the language and keyboard have not been saved in cleartext storage 2.091
When I shutdown Tails and wait for the computer to power off 7.146
And I start Tails from USB drive "__internal" with network unplugged 41.490
Then the Welcome Screen's language is set to English 0.297
After features/support/hooks.rb:339 1.143
After features/support/hooks.rb:108 0.058
Tags: @product
1:17.339
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.016
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 8.135
When I set the language to Italian (it) 5.567
And I save the language and keyboard options in cleartext storage 2.421
Then the "it" language and keyboard have been saved in cleartext storage 0.147
When I set the language to French (fr) 4.514
Then the "fr" language and keyboard have been saved in cleartext storage 0.158
And I shutdown Tails and wait for the computer to power off 4.374
And I start Tails from USB drive "__internal" with network unplugged 41.534
Then the "fr" language and keyboard have been saved in cleartext storage 0.401
And the Welcome Screen's language is set to French 0.770
When I log in to a new session 9.270
Then the language is set to French 0.042
After features/support/hooks.rb:339 0.928
After features/support/hooks.rb:108 0.020
Tags: @product
2:49.743
Before features/support/hooks.rb:274 0.000
Before features/support/hooks.rb:281 0.015
Given I have started Tails without network from a USB drive without a persistent partition and logged in 9.353
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.432
And I create a persistent partition 31.482
And I manually store legacy localization settings in Persistent Storage 0.209
When I shutdown Tails and wait for the computer to power off 10.224
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 38.446
Then the Welcome Screen's language is set to English 0.277
And the Welcome Screen's formats is set to United States 0.196
When I enable persistence 11.686
Then the Welcome Screen's language is set to German 0.638
And the Welcome Screen's formats is set to France 0.194
When I set the language to Italian (it) 4.521
Then the language and keyboard have not been saved in cleartext storage 2.091
When I save the language and keyboard options in cleartext storage 2.380
Then the "it" language and keyboard have been saved in cleartext storage 0.099
And I shutdown Tails and wait for the computer to power off 2.850
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 40.242
Then the Welcome Screen's language is set to Italian 0.578
And the Welcome Screen's formats is set to Italy 0.201
When I enable persistence 12.694
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.227
And the Welcome Screen's language is set to Italian 0.713
After features/support/hooks.rb:339 0.601
After features/support/hooks.rb:108 0.034